Patient's Query

Hello doctor,

I have acne and dandruff problem and I consulted you in January. This time I notice patches and uneven skin toning. Still, I have pimples on my face. Please help.

Answered by Dr. Priya B. T

Hi,

Welcome to icliniq.com.

You are in the age group of getting acne. Oil glands are active. Do not meddle with it. Drink a lot of water. Before periods acne will increase. For pimples, apply Clindac A gel (Clindamycin) on the acne spots for two weeks. Then change to Deriva CMS (Adapalene and Clindamycin) gel (three hours a day) for two weeks. Apply Melaglow Rich cream to the black spots in the night, and take capsule Microdox LBX 100 (Doxycyline and Lacticacid bacillus) once a day for 10 days at night. For dandruff, please continue Tarry shine shampoo or Keto-C shampoo twice a week.

Patient's Query

Thank you doctor,

Pimples are still there but my dandruff and hair fall is too much. I want a glowing clean face. Because of dandruff, I think I am getting more pimples and also I notice some allergy below my elbow of both my hands. I have attached the photos of my face and the allergy.

Answered by Dr. Priya B. T

Hi,

Welcome back to icliniq.com.

I have seen the images (attachment removed to protect patient identity). You have got phrynoderma over the elbows. Apply urea based cream on the spots like Zenmoist cream. You cannot stop dandruff and acne like you switch off the buttons. This age group is prone for acne. As far as I have seen the pictures, you are not having so severe form of acne. If you insist, please search and know about capsule Isotretinoin. If it is fine with you, I will start it. Continue dandruff shampoo.
